How Our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ration Process Works

When you call us for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ration, you can trust that our team will follow a proven process to get your home back in order. We’ll start by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the leak. From there, we’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water, dry out the affected area, and restore your belongings to their pre-loss condition. Every step of the way, we’ll keep you informed and involved in the process, so you know exactly what to expect.

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our technicians will arrive at your home, equipped with moisture-detecting meters and thermal imaging cameras to identify the extent of the damage. We’ll take precise measurements and document the affected area, so we can provide a clear plan for the restoration process. Our goal is to get you back to normal as quickly and efficiently as possible, without sacrificing quality or attention to detail.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using powerful pumps and wet/dry vacuums, we’ll ext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Our team will work quickly and methodically to remove every last drop of water, so we can proceed with the drying and restoration process.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

With the water removed,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ry out the affected area and reduce the humidity levels. This may involve using desiccant dehumidifiers, air movers, or other equipment to speed up the drying process. Our goal is to get your home back to a safe and healthy environment, as quickly as possible.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the area is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ize all surfaces to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This may involve using antimicrobial treatments, disinfectants, or other specialized cleaning products to ensure your home is safe and healthy.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ged walls, floors, or ceilings, as well as restoring your belongings and personal items. Our goal is to get you back to normal, with minimal disruption to your daily life.

Warning Signs You Need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ration

Don’t ignore the warning signs – water damage can be a silent killer, wreaking havoc on your home and your health. Look out for these common signs of laundry room water dam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your laundry room or surrounding areas can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ore these smells – they can show the presence of mold, mildew, or other bacteria.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a leaky pipe, a burst water heater, or other water damage issue. Don’t wait until it’s too late – call us today to schedule an assessment and repair.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, particularly in areas around the laundry room. Don’t ignore these signs – water damage can spread quickly, causing costly repairs and health risks.

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or leak with minimal water damage Yes No You can likely fix the issue yourself with a DIY kit or some basic plumbing tools.
Major leak with extensive water damage No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Hidden water damage behind walls or under flooring No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air hidden damage, preventing further damage and health risks.
Water damage with vis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and remediate mold and mildew, preventing health risks.
Water damage with significant structural damage No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to safely repair and restore your home, ensuring a safe and healthy environment.

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ration Cost in Reading, MA

The cost of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ration in Reading, MA can vary widely, depending on the severity and extent of the damage. On average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a minor leak with minimal water damage. But, if the damage is more extensive, the cost can range from $2,500 to $10,000 or more.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needs
Laundry Room Repair and Re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and labor costs
Mold and Mildew Remediation $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and labor costs
Water Heater Replacement or Repair $500 – $2,000 Make and model of water heater, labor costs, and parts needed
Plumbing Repair or Replacement $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and labor costs
